What is Valerian Root Tea?



Valerian root tea is a natural remedy with a long history of traditional use for sleep disorders and anxiety. The tea is made by steeping the roots of the valerian plant in hot water, which releases its active compounds, including valerenic acid and other volatile oils. These chemicals work in different ways to produce a calming and relaxing effect on the brain and body. How Does Valerian Root Tea Work for Anxiety?


Valerian root tea has been found to be effective in easing symptoms of anxiety, but how does it work? Research suggests that valerenic acid, one of the active compounds in valerian root, may interact with the brain's neurotransmitters to promote feelings of calmness and relaxation. This acid activates the GABA-A receptors in the brain, which are responsible for reducing excitability and increasing relaxation. By enhancing the effects of GABA, valerian root tea may help to reduce anxiety, agitation, and nervousness. Additionally, valerian root tea has been found to have sedative effects, which may also contribute to its ability to calm the mind and promote a sense of calm. Overall, valerian root tea appears to be a promising natural remedy for people struggling with anxiety, and its effectiveness may come down to its ability to enhance the brain's natural relaxation processes.
